The Bluebell (Campanulaceae Juss.) In The Rock Debris Of High Upland Part Of The Small Caucasus
Description
13 kinds of the bluebell (Campanulaceae) family in the rock debris of high upland part of the Small Caucasus have been found. Their habitat has been noted in the pebbly and stony territories. The potential and real seed productivity have been determined. The sistematical arealogic and ecolobiological analysis of flora have been carried out.
